The updated and very very popular Google Earth Extension for AutoCAD has been updated for AutoCAD 2009 so that it now runs on three AutoCAD versions. There have also been a few updates by the developer Thomas Inzinga:
- Support for the new AutoCAD 2009 Geographic Location object
- Numerous bug fixes.
The Google Earth Extension is a great way to get your designs into Google Earth or reference Google Earth in AutoCAD.
"Using the simple wizard-driven interface, you can publish your 3D models from AutoCAD or select AutoCAD-based products directly into Google Earth™. The technology preview is available for 2007, 2008, and 2009 versions."
